Publisher Description

Forgotten Names Recalled Stories from the Singapore Cenotaph commemorates the outbreak of the First World War 100 years ago. The Singapore cenotaph facing the Padang was built in 1922 as a tribute to the men from the Straits Settlements of Singapore, Penang and Malacca who gave their lives in the Great War of 1914 to 1918. Of the 124 names on the bronze plaques, 112 have been recalled in this book of stories that offers a small window into the past. These are stories of ordinary men, not the politicians and generals of history books. Through newspaper articles, letters, military and civil records, Rosemary Lim has pieced together a collection of insights into the lives and times of our men of the cenotaph.
